package com.google.gwt.collections;
import com.google.gwt.junit.client.GWTTestCase;
/**
* Tests immutable arrays.
*/
public class ImmutableArrayTest extends GWTTestCase {
private boolean assertionsEnabled;
@Override
public String getModuleName() {
return null;
}
public void gwtSetUp() {
assertionsEnabled = this.getClass().desiredAssertionStatus();
}
public void testAccessOutOfBounds() {
// Do not test undefined behavior with assertions disabled
if (!assertionsEnabled) {
return;
}
MutableArray<Integer> ma;
ImmutableArray<Integer> ia;
ma = CollectionFactory.createMutableArray();
ma.add(1);
ma.add(2);
ia = ma.freeze();
try {
ia.get(ia.size());
fail("Expected an assertion failure");
} catch (AssertionError e) {
assertEquals(("Index " + ia.size() + " was not in the acceptable range [" + 0 + ", " + ia.size()
+ ")"), e.getMessage());
}
assertEquals(2, ma.size());
ma = CollectionFactory.createMutableArray();
// No elements added
ia = ma.freeze();
try {
ia.get(ia.size());
fail("Expected an assertion failure");
} catch (AssertionError e) {
assertEquals("Attempt to get an element from an immutable empty array", e.getMessage());
}
}
public void testFreezeEmptyArray() {
MutableArray<String> ma = CollectionFactory.createMutableArray();
// No elements added
ImmutableArray<String> ia = ma.freeze();
assertEquals(0, ia.size());
}
public void testFreezeMutable() {
MutableArray<String> ma = CollectionFactory.createMutableArray();
ma.add("pear");
ma.add("apple");
ImmutableArray<String> ia = ma.freeze();
assertEquals(2, ia.size());
assertEquals("pear", ia.get(0));
assertEquals("apple", ia.get(1));
}
public void testFreezeSingleElement() {
MutableArray<String> ma = CollectionFactory.createMutableArray();
ma.add("pear");
ImmutableArray<String> ia = ma.freeze();
assertEquals(1, ia.size());
assertEquals("pear", ia.get(0));
}
public void testImmutableNoCopy() {
MutableArray<String> ma = CollectionFactory.createMutableArray();
ma.add("pear");
ma.add("apple");
ImmutableArrayImpl<String> ia1 = (ImmutableArrayImpl<String>) ma.freeze();
assertTrue(ma.elems == ia1.elems);
ImmutableArrayImpl<String> ia2 = (ImmutableArrayImpl<String>) ma.freeze();
assertTrue(ia1.elems == ia2.elems);
}
